Final Qualifying Result
Final Qualifying Result
Top 10
1. Teemu Leino - Xray - 18 laps in 5:06.772
2. Oscar Cabezas - Serpent - 18 laps in 5:08.371
3. Jilles Groskamp - Xray - 18 laps in 5:08.931
4. Alessio Mazzeo - Serpent - 18 laps in 5:09.569
5. Darren Johnson - Team Magic - 18 laps in 5:09.612
6. Adrien Bertin - Kyosho - 18 laps in 5:09.880
7. Giuseppe D’Angelo - Mugen - 18 laps in 5:10.332
8. Mark Green - Serpent - 18 laps in 5:10.968
9. Juanito Hidalgo - Team Magic - 18 laps in 5:11.315
10.Josue Artiles - Mugen - 18 laps in 5:11.400

Yes others can bump up from the quarters etc too but after participating in two of these Euros I saw how after a couple of bump-ups your car is no longer in its optimum condition, never mind the engine. You can change engines but you can't change your chassis and even then you'll never have enough time to do it before you're having to rush off to the next round of finals.
The top 4 guys have the best chances of course because they get a 10 minute private session and everything is in tip-top condition ready to battle.
I agree with Razzor though that its good to see that despite the giant team of the very best European drivers, XRay did not lock out the top spots. Goes to show that any of the top car makes (Serpent, XRay, TM, Mugen and Kyosho) can perform.
